This is how I spent my weekend after a visit with Venom.... National Fallen Firefighters Memorial 2009 - a set on Flickr

I came home a totally different man than when I left. There'* is something about spending time with 123 families who are all grieving the loss of a firefighter in their family. Though it was not particularly a sad event, it was geared towards making certain that the family survives the ordeal, mourns in their own way and finds a network to help them over the years.

I was honored to be part of the escort team for National Park Service Firefighter Andrew Palmer from Sequim, Washington. Andrew lost is life when a tree fell on him on his first day on the fire line on July 25, 2008 : NPS Mourns Death Of Firefighter Andy Palmer (NPS Digest). Andrew was 18 years old.
